Mining companies holding career fair Monday at UNLV

Two big mining companies have scheduled a Monday career fair at the University of Nevada, Las Vegas.

Barrick Gold Corp., the world’s largest gold miner, and Geotemps, a mining industry staffing agency, have scheduled the job fair for 9 a.m. to 1 p.m. inside the UNLV Student Union.

The companies listed more than 60 openings in Northern Nevada for electrical engineers, electricians, operations supervisors, project superintendents, administrative assistants, miners, geologists, equipment operators and safety and health coordinators, among others.

Geotemps said it will work one-on-one with candidates from other fields to determine how their skills might fit mining.
